Choose Carefully, Tread Lightly

Choose carefully your time and space...
may it always be by choice, never by force
where you find yourself expressing
with your body the shape of your mind.

All have a place in the puzzle of Earth,
though few find it, and many suffer
following the dreams of others,
in greed and schemes and half-baked hopes
that come to nothing in the end.

Choose carefully your sacred place
and tread lightly - or not at all
for not all of it can hold your weight
nor fulfill the desires of your heart:
Be aware of all the limitations --
nature is but a child - willing but weak.

Choose carefully where your eyes rest
and do not hold what is there with money
or even in dream or memory.
For what is held on to, always dies,
but what remains free, always lives.

Choose carefully where you put your paddle,
disturb the waters not, go gently and silent
whether the water be calm or stormy;
whether it be muddy or clear --
be not the one who upsets the balance:
you will be well repaid when your turn comes
to lay at rest all that you chose to pass by.

Choose carefully and be aware,
but do not hang on, you are a bird on the wing
and how swiftly will Autumn come
and the call of migration pull you away
perhaps never to return: let the rains of winter
wash away your nest of mud and sticks.
